termux中安装kaliLinux安装完成后如何进入系统?
时间: 2024-11-30 13:22:04 浏览: 189
在Termux中安装Kali Linux 需要注意的是,Termux本身是一个Linux环境模拟器,用于Android设备上运行Unix/Linux命令行工具,而Kali Linux 是一个完整的Linux发行版。通常来说,Termux并不直接支持像虚拟机那样完整地运行独立的操作系统。不过,如果你确实想要在Termux内体验类似操作系统的功能,一种可能的做法是安装Linux内核模块,但这并非官方推荐的方式,可能会导致不稳定。
如果你想在Termux内部使用轻量级的Linux发行版或工具集,你可以尝试安装基于 BusyBox 的Chroot 或者 Docker 容器。例如,可以安装`debootstrap`来构建一个小的Linux根文件系统,并通过`chroot`进入。以下是大致步骤:
1. **通过Chroot**:
- `apt update && apt install debootstrap`
- 创建一个新的目录并下载Linux发行版:
```bash
mkdir kali_chroot; cd kali_chroot
wget https://cdimage.kali.org/kali-linux-latest-x86_64.iso
```
- 使用`debootstrap`创建基本的文件系统结构:
```bash
debootstrap kali xenial .
```
- 进入新创建的Linux环境:
```bash
chroot ./kali
```
2. **通过Docker** (需先安装Docker for Android):
- 下载一个Docker镜像:
```bash
docker pull kali:latest
```
- 启动容器:
```bash
docker run --name my-kali -it kali:latest /bin/bash
```
记得这都不是标准操作,风险较高,而且性能有限。更推荐在物理设备或云服务器上安装并管理完整的Kali Linux系统。如果只是想学习Linux命令,Termux内置的Ubuntu或Debian已经足够了。
阅读全文
相关推荐

















